A good addition to a small local shopping strip, which is open early for coffee on the way to work, and is one of the few places where you can still get a coffee in the afternoon in Canberra.
Outdoor tables are pleasant in warmer weather and there is access to an outdoor heating unit during winter.
Standard, basic coffee is of good quality and price, even if it lacks the wow factor of some other places in town.
It serves its community well, muffins, pies, soups and things for kids
